On Fri, 15 Nov 2019, Christoph M. Becker via curl-library wrote:

current versions of PHP won't build against current libcurl master[1], because CURLE_OBSOLETE20 has been re-used as CURLE_HTTP3[2]. While this could of course be fixed in PHP, it looks like quite some other code may be affected as well[3], so maybe it would be good to additionally re-add CURLE_OBSOLETE20 as alias for CURLE_HTTP3, like it had been done for CURLE_OBSOLETE16 before[3].

Thanks, we should really do that. My mistake.
